From seasoned equestrians to curious kids meeting their first pony, Lazee G Ranch’s annual Horse Day offered something for everyone, while celebrating the joy of horses and farm life with hands-on experiences for all ages.
On Sunday, Lazee G Ranch opened the barn doors and had the saddles ready to ride as part of the annual “Horse Day” at the Maidstone location. The event provides the public with a chance to check out the ranch's facilities, learn about the programming offered at the farm, and interact with the animals.
“It’s such a great experience for everyone. We’ve got a couple of new drill teams and right now, we’ve got a lot of baby animals around the farm, which people can see up close,” Brenda Gagnon, Owner and Operator of Lazee G Ranch, said. “Events like this take a lot and we probably had over 30 volunteers. But everyone is excited, the girls really look forward to having the public come out, showcase their skills, and talk horses.”
The open house style event allowed participants to move around the ranch at their own pace, interacting with different volunteers and stations. While the weather may have halted and interfered with some of the outside portions of the event, Gagnon and the volunteers around the ranch were prepared and had spread activities, stations, and traffic throughout the buildings around the ranch.
As a part of the event, Lazee G Ranch offered riding demonstrations from members of its riding programs, while providing children an opportunity to ride ponies and horses around the ring. Lazee G Ranch also collected non-perishable food items to be donated to a local mission.
“We get a lot of calls around this time, and a lot of people are excited to come out to the farm. It’s also great to be able to support those in need,” Gagnon said. “For the girls, it's one of their first times to perform this year, while it's not in the big ring, it is still a great learning experience. We hope to have other shows this year, including our big Shodeo in July. We always look forward to having the public out and seeing what we have to offer.”
Gagnon noted all of Lazee G’s events or programs can be found on its social media page. She is thankful for all who attended and supports the ranch and looks forward to seeing everyone back soon.
